Symptoms That You Need Animal Exclusion Services

Recognizing the signs that point to a requirement for animal removal services is essential for maintaining a safe home space. Homeowners should remain watchful for unusual noises in attics or walls, which may indicate the presence of pests. Moreover, unexplained damage to property, such as gnawed wires or chewed furniture, can be a clear indication of an animal infestation.

Discovering droppings or marks around the dwelling is another sign that professional intervention might be necessary. Unpleasant odors, often from pest droppings or dead animals, can also reveal a serious problem. Additionally, sightings of wildlife in or around the property, especially during the daytime, may indicate that animals are encroaching on living spaces. Prompt attention to these signs can prevent more serious problems and guarantee the safety and comfort of the dwelling. Preventive Strategies Applied

After successfully removing animals, avoidance plans play an important role in protecting the property against future infestations. Professionals commonly apply a thorough approach that starts with a meticulous inspection of the property to identify potential entry points and weak spots. Common actions like sealing cracks, installing screens, and reinforcing vents are done to keep animals from coming back. Moreover, landscaping changes such as trimming dense vegetation and managing food sources assist in reducing attractants. Regular upkeep and monitoring are suggested to maintain the effectiveness of these strategies. Property owners might also get advice on best practices, like proper waste disposal and securing pet food. By actively tackling these concerns, the risk of re-infestation is noticeably minimized, ensuring a safer and more secure environment.

Guidelines for Warding off Forthcoming Wild animal Concerns

Preventing potential wildlife issues requires preventive measures and a keen eye for possible entry points. Homeowners should consistently inspect their properties for cracks in foundations, attics, and vents, sealing any openings to deter animal invasion. Proper maintenance of landscaping is vital; overgrown vegetation can provide refuge for pests. Additionally, securely storing food and garbage in pest-proof containers minimizes attraction to wildlife.

Installing protective fencing can also serve as a deterrent, especially around vegetable patches or grazing areas. It is important to keep outdoor zones orderly by eliminating litter and clutter that may shelter animals. Informing family occupants about animal consciousness and the significance of noting sightings can foster a defensive mindset. Ultimately, regular monitoring and upkeep of the premises establish an inhospitable space for wildlife, greatly decreasing the chance of recurring infestations and providing tranquility for homeowners.
